Output 34ccbd149b8ef074b08f941d9ae0e8f865f9bf5dfc0a2b6934ce17693460ccc7:0

value
7624205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c70b505fd2da899db272ba774dcadd9347ffc44 OP_EQUAL
address
37CbV5hFSE3qEWXjST3FsMSiQ7A9a7faxq
transaction
34ccbd149b8ef074b08f941d9ae0e8f865f9bf5dfc0a2b6934ce17693460ccc7
spent
true